Commit graph

202 commits

Author SHA1 Message Date
renovate[bot] d67b43a043 Update dependency i18next to v23.12.2 2024-07-19 07:57:59 -04:00
renovate[bot] c1e22bd7d5 Update dependency husky to v9.1.1 2024-07-18 11:17:14 -04:00
renovate[bot] 67a591a08c Update dependency husky to v9.1.0 2024-07-17 13:04:55 -04:00
renovate[bot] d517abd597 Update dependency eslint-plugin-prettier to v5.2.1 2024-07-17 10:56:26 -04:00
renovate[bot] 71f6856329 Update dependency @types/node to v20.14.11 2024-07-16 20:31:09 -04:00
renovate[bot] 40c4269703 Update dependency terser to v5.31.3 2024-07-16 13:50:38 -04:00
renovate[bot] 7329db55f3 Update dependency prettier-plugin-packagejson to v2.5.1 2024-07-16 04:59:52 -04:00
renovate[bot] 0f1e1a3dd6 Update typescript-eslint monorepo to v7.16.1 2024-07-15 14:20:28 -04:00
renovate[bot] 492d86457c Update dependency prettier to v3.3.3 2024-07-15 10:02:55 -04:00
renovate[bot] a53aba545b Update dependency @babel/core to v7.24.9 2024-07-15 08:36:37 -04:00
renovate[bot] df58dcc6ad Update dependency i18next to v23.12.1 2024-07-14 11:40:19 -04:00
renovate[bot] 6790fbac32 Update dependency i18next to v23.12.0 2024-07-14 08:15:48 -04:00
renovate[bot] 7a30476d89 Update eslint monorepo to v9.7.0 2024-07-12 17:45:49 -04:00
renovate[bot] 02a70beeef Update dependency sass to v1.77.8 2024-07-11 18:31:07 -04:00
renovate[bot] 7b97cf9177 Update dependency webpack to v5.93.0 2024-07-11 16:20:12 -04:00
renovate[bot] f51b03ed79 Update babel monorepo to v7.24.8 2024-07-11 11:45:10 -04:00
renovate[bot] c1b94f5c21 Update dependency rimraf to v6.0.1 2024-07-10 14:12:36 -04:00
renovate[bot] 85cbc5bc71 Update dependency terser to v5.31.2 2024-07-10 07:35:43 -04:00
renovate[bot] cf3e506a8c Update dependency sass to v1.77.7 2024-07-09 20:08:14 -04:00
renovate[bot] 7746ee3c2e Update dependency rimraf to v6 2024-07-09 01:08:22 -04:00
renovate[bot] d02962b17a Update dependency rimraf to v5.0.9 2024-07-09 00:00:36 -04:00
renovate[bot] be3f631edc Update dependency qs to v6.12.3 2024-07-08 20:11:12 -04:00
renovate[bot] 5cd399a4b1 Update typescript-eslint monorepo to v7.16.0 2024-07-08 15:13:51 -04:00
renovate[bot] 834b7e4a69 Update dependency highlight.js to v11.10.0 2024-07-06 19:11:26 -04:00
renovate[bot] 318d61e7cf Update dependency rimraf to v5.0.8 2024-07-06 01:37:57 -04:00
renovate[bot] ecb2637bdc Update dependency @types/node to v20.14.10 2024-07-05 16:00:20 -04:00
renovate[bot] eaa337eef3 Update dependency globals to v15.8.0 2024-07-02 08:54:40 -04:00
renovate[bot] f4aa9b22a1 Update dependency prettier-plugin-organize-imports to v4 2024-07-01 23:25:39 -04:00
renovate[bot] 4d4b18d9c5 Update dependency typescript to v5.5.3 2024-07-01 20:08:29 -04:00
renovate[bot] 2d3d434873 Update dependency qs to v6.12.2 2024-07-01 17:13:22 -04:00
renovate[bot] acd4e5a7f4 Update typescript-eslint monorepo to v7.15.0 2024-07-01 14:21:02 -04:00
renovate[bot] 75b5852aa6 Update dependency globals to v15.7.0 2024-06-30 08:44:30 -04:00
renovate[bot] 790fef60cc Update eslint monorepo to v9.6.0 2024-06-28 15:53:47 -04:00
renovate[bot] 1016d379be Update dependency @types/node to v20.14.9 2024-06-25 18:46:22 -04:00
renovate[bot] 98fc9e2c66 Update typescript-eslint monorepo to v7.14.1 2024-06-24 14:46:38 -04:00
renovate[bot] 0ede7b3d13 Update dependency @types/node to v20.14.8 2024-06-22 05:51:21 -04:00
renovate[bot] c2356cda3a Update dependency @types/node to v20.14.7 2024-06-20 18:43:24 -04:00
renovate[bot] b677179317 Update dependency typescript to v5.5.2 2024-06-20 16:11:34 -04:00
renovate[bot] 680488b51f Update dependency eslint-plugin-jsx-a11y to v6.9.0 2024-06-20 03:59:24 -04:00
renovate[bot] 3bcb12eff9 Update dependency webpack to v5.92.1 2024-06-19 14:23:21 -04:00
renovate[bot] 1299f7ce07 Update dependency @types/node to v20.14.6 2024-06-19 12:20:36 -04:00
renovate[bot] ab5d45199b Update dependency @types/node to v20.14.5 2024-06-18 05:13:24 -04:00
renovate[bot] fbbe66a2af Update dependency @types/node to v20.14.4 2024-06-17 19:52:22 -04:00
renovate[bot] 1ee1bdeaa9 Update dependency sass to v1.77.6 2024-06-17 18:32:36 -04:00
renovate[bot] 415d303b93 Update dependency @types/node to v20.14.3 2024-06-17 18:11:12 -04:00
renovate[bot] bcce1ecda9 Update typescript-eslint monorepo to v7.13.1 2024-06-17 14:48:59 -04:00
renovate[bot] 0bd5939a7e Update dependency globals to v15.6.0 2024-06-17 08:31:29 -04:00
renovate[bot] 06aae28094 Update dependency globals to v15.5.0 2024-06-15 23:29:40 -04:00
renovate[bot] 35b3cec2d4 Update eslint monorepo to v9.5.0 2024-06-14 18:48:14 -04:00
renovate[bot] f984acaa5c Update dependency lint-staged to v15.2.7 2024-06-12 16:37:38 -04:00
renovate[bot] 30b228ef0f Update dependency sass to v1.77.5 2024-06-11 20:26:24 -04:00
renovate[bot] d44e257163 Update dependency lint-staged to v15.2.6 2024-06-11 15:56:02 -04:00
renovate[bot] 7c789e9213 Update dependency webpack to v5.92.0 2024-06-11 11:43:41 -04:00
renovate[bot] c5cf6d1c7b Update dependency prettier to v3.3.2 2024-06-11 05:46:47 -04:00
renovate[bot] 7e215cb2b5 Update typescript-eslint monorepo to v7.13.0 2024-06-10 15:43:47 -04:00
renovate[bot] 9a72a48c6b Update dependency lemmy-js-client to v0.19.4 2024-06-06 18:53:16 -04:00
renovate[bot] 3bc4302ef0 Update dependency globals to v15.4.0 2024-06-06 12:27:25 -04:00
renovate[bot] e9850bb22e Update dependency terser to v5.31.1 2024-06-06 09:12:43 -04:00
renovate[bot] 8a6b074509 Update dependency qreator to v9.3.0 2024-06-05 17:52:59 -04:00
renovate[bot] 51cbd2e8bb Update dependency qreator to v9.2.1 2024-06-05 14:26:32 -04:00
SleeplessOne1917 4d07ca7662
Update deps and package manager (#2505) 2024-06-05 11:24:28 -04:00
renovate[bot] 68ce9b17fe Update dependency @types/node to v20.14.2 2024-06-05 10:40:23 -04:00
renovate[bot] d1540db533 Update dependency prettier to v3.3.1 2024-06-05 07:22:02 -04:00
renovate[bot] f33711acb0 Update dependency @types/node to v20.14.1 2024-06-03 21:16:44 -04:00
renovate[bot] e3a11648c9 Update typescript-eslint monorepo to v7.12.0 2024-06-03 16:14:49 -04:00
renovate[bot] a02a2341d1 Update dependency @types/node to v20.14.0 2024-06-02 19:55:01 -04:00
renovate[bot] 14ae45fe95 Update typescript-eslint monorepo to v7.11.0 2024-06-01 15:59:05 -04:00
renovate[bot] cdd902abde Update dependency prettier to v3.3.0 2024-06-01 14:55:46 -04:00
renovate[bot] 8e68524d15 Update eslint monorepo to v9.4.0 2024-06-01 14:47:59 -04:00
renovate[bot] 22397879ce Update dependency qreator to v9.2.0 2024-06-01 14:39:19 -04:00
renovate[bot] 28dfb69c9a Update dependency @types/node to v20.13.0 2024-06-01 14:36:02 -04:00
renovate[bot] 1994618a21
Update dependency sass to v1.77.4 (#2486)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-31 22:30:19 -04:00
renovate[bot] 9fa4d59f10
Update dependency lint-staged to v15.2.5 (#2485)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-31 22:30:08 -04:00
renovate[bot] 83ea77e0fb
Update dependency css-loader to v7.1.2 (#2484)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-31 22:15:58 -04:00
renovate[bot] 2668533196
Update babel monorepo to v7.24.6 (#2483)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-31 22:15:41 -04:00
renovate[bot] ed3f280c48
Update dependency i18next to v23.11.5 (#2477)
* Update dependency i18next to v23.11.5

* Update dependency i18next to v23.11.5

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Dessalines <tyhou13@gmx.com>
Co-authored-by: Dessalines <dessalines@users.noreply.github.com>
2024-05-21 14:29:37 -04:00
renovate[bot] 57d01928b3
Update typescript-eslint monorepo to v7.10.0 (#2479)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-21 14:29:00 -04:00
SleeplessOne1917 1f7c8dd1b0
Fix video thumbnail override issue (#2474)
* Fix video thumbnail override issue

* Cleanup

* Make thumbnails always show up, even on mobile

---------

Co-authored-by: Dessalines <tyhou13@gmx.com>
2024-05-21 14:25:21 -04:00
SleeplessOne1917 139514cac8
Use non-deprecated QR library (#2475) 2024-05-21 14:20:32 -04:00
renovate[bot] 7875a793b3
Update dependency @types/markdown-it to v14 (#2470)
* Update dependency @types/markdown-it to v14

* Fixing markdown import.

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Dessalines <tyhou13@gmx.com>
2024-05-15 13:46:26 -04:00
renovate[bot] 9e94d404f8
Update dependency eslint to v9 (#2472)
* Update dependency eslint to v9

* Fixing eslint.

* Forgot to add file.

* Fixing

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Dessalines <tyhou13@gmx.com>
2024-05-15 13:30:03 -04:00
renovate[bot] 67dd5d164f
Update dependency rimraf to v5.0.7 (#2464)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-15 11:07:18 -04:00
renovate[bot] d07ed0a90a
Update dependency style-loader to v4 (#2473)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-15 11:07:00 -04:00
renovate[bot] e7bc05a446
Update dependency css-loader to v7 (#2471)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-15 11:06:50 -04:00
renovate[bot] 3d65ff6c02
Update typescript-eslint monorepo to v7.9.0 (#2469)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-15 11:06:41 -04:00
renovate[bot] 52b814945e
Update dependency terser to v5.31.0 (#2468)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-15 10:48:42 -04:00
renovate[bot] 44ca1d14b7
Update dependency sass to v1.77.1 (#2467)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-15 10:48:29 -04:00
renovate[bot] 007fdb3e85
Update dependency emoji-mart to v5.6.0 (#2466)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-15 10:48:17 -04:00
renovate[bot] 8599afcd11
Update dependency @emoji-mart/data to v1.2.1 (#2465)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-15 10:47:56 -04:00
renovate[bot] 51aa169ca3
Update dependency i18next to v23.11.4 (#2463)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-15 10:47:45 -04:00
renovate[bot] 633a83cc7c
Update dependency @types/node to v20.12.12 (#2462)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-15 10:47:34 -04:00
renovate[bot] a6882ce693
Update dependency @types/markdown-it to v13.0.8 (#2461)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-15 10:47:20 -04:00
renovate[bot] 403b5292e5
Update babel monorepo to v7.24.5 (#2460)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2024-05-15 10:47:10 -04:00
SleeplessOne1917 d89dc07e71
Mod action history (#2437)
* Add action for viewing moderation history

* Add translations

* Remove unnecessary function

* Update packageManager

* Package manager
2024-04-23 22:34:52 -04:00
SleeplessOne1917 643c1f6f01
Make confirm popup for adult consent (#2419)
* Make confirm popup for adult consent

* Fix import

* Fix blur and adjust user settings

* Make confirmation popup more stylish

* Add setting to site settings form

* Fix modal bug

* Put adult consent logic all in one place

* Make modal use markdown

* Fix consent modal showing up for currently logged in admin

* Add go-back redirect countdown

* Center modal title

* Handle enable_nsfw correctly

* Blur background of modal to hide spicy things

* Add translations
2024-04-18 19:54:16 -04:00
Dessalines 9dcaff4301
Adding image upload views for admins and profiles. (#2424)
* Adding image upload views for admins and profiles.

* Upgraded lemmy-js-client dep.

* Removing this.

* Upgrade to pnpm v9.0.1

---------

Co-authored-by: SleeplessOne1917 <28871516+SleeplessOne1917@users.noreply.github.com>
2024-04-17 08:37:58 -04:00
Dessalines 9aa1e06ae3
Adding alt_text and custom_thumbnail to post form. (#2404)
* Adding alt_text and custom_thumbnail to post form.

* Adding htmlFor, and only show alt_text if its an image post.

* Only show custom thumbnail url field when its not an image post.
2024-04-04 19:59:13 -04:00
SleeplessOne1917 579aea40d0
Notify users that they are banned from a community (#2397)
* Add banned blurb to community sidebar

* Hide interactable parts of posts and comments when banned from community

* Add translation

* Fix some typescript errors

* Fix typescript errors

* PR feedback
2024-03-26 19:03:02 -04:00
matc-pub 201e5fcd53
Lazy loading less common languages for syntax highlighting (#2388)
* Use fewer syntax highlighter languages.

Reduces client.js size by about 250kB (800kB uncompressed)

Common languages:
bash, c, cpp, csharp, css, diff, go, graphql, ini, java, javascript,
json, kotlin, less, lua, makefile, markdown, objectivec, perl,
php-template, php, plaintext, python-repl, python, r, ruby, rust, scss,
shell, sql, swift, typescript, vbnet, wasm, xml, yaml

Additionally enabled languages:
dockerfile, pgsql

* Configurable syntax highlighter languages

Allows to individually enable languages.

* Lazy load syntax highlighter languages

Allows to enable additional languages that will not be autodetected.

* Include highlight.js in dynamic import check
2024-03-14 08:31:07 -04:00
SleeplessOne1917 eb5095b686
Bump dependencies (#2378)
Co-authored-by: SleeplessOne1917 <insomnia-void@protonmail.com>
2024-02-26 19:16:41 -05:00
SleeplessOne1917 71c2206405
Update deps (#2357)
Co-authored-by: SleeplessOne1917 <insomnia-void@protonmail.com>
2024-02-05 23:30:41 -05:00
Dessalines 140ff8271c
Move to pnpm (#2345)
* Switch from yarn to pnpm.

* Moving from yarn to pnpm.

* Try 2

* Try 3

* Try 4

* Try 5

* Try 6

* Adding qs.

* Try corepack.

* Remove comment.

* Adding prebuild:dev.

* Some fixes.

* Fixing up husky.

* Fixing up version and others.
2024-01-28 22:09:08 -05:00